Ladies and Gentlethem - Feeling a little upset?
Have you tried hypnosis, psychoanalysis, smelling salts and it just doesn’t work? Try The City for Incurable Women!
Paris, 1880s. In a psychiatric hospital, female patients performed ‘hysteria’ for the public. The doctors went to extraordinary lengths to prove their theories about the four stages of madness.
International theatre-collective, fish in a dress, follows the thread of the history of hysteria as the audience becomes complicit in an outrageous tale of medical misogyny.
(Warning: hysteria cure not included)
Devised by fish in a dress.
Cast: Charlotte McBurney
Director: Christina Deinsberger
Writer: Helena McBurney
Design: Vanessa Sampaio Borgmann
Sound: Bella Kear

This show is part of Futures Festival, a work-in-process festival curated by Pleasance Associate Artists. Each artist presents a week of work around a theme relevant to them and the work they are making.
This show is part of the week The Future Is HETEROSEXUAL curated by piss/ CARNATION. A week of shows exploring queer futurity, family, and erotics.
